What α,α-dichlorotoluene is

α,α-dichlorotoluene is a colorless oily liquid with a pungent odor. Its molecular formula is C7H6Cl2 and its molecular weight is 161.03 g/mol. It boils at 205 °C, melts at -16.4 °C.

Under the GHS it carries the signal word Danger. It is classed as carcinogens.

03 · GHS classification

α,α-dichlorotoluene hazard classification

Harmonised classification under CLP Annex VI. This is the legally binding classification in the EU; other jurisdictions may differ.

α,α-dichlorotoluene pictograms and signal word

Signal wordDanger

α,α-dichlorotoluene hazard class and category

GHS hazard classes α,α-dichlorotoluene falls into
Hazard class Category From code Pictogram
Acute toxicity - oral GHS chapter 3.1 Category 4 H302 GHS07
Acute toxicity - inhalation GHS chapter 3.1 Category 3 H331 GHS06
Skin corrosion/irritation GHS chapter 3.2 Category 2 H315 GHS07
Serious eye damage/eye irritation GHS chapter 3.3 Category 1 H318 GHS05
Carcinogenicity GHS chapter 3.6 Category 2 H351 GHS08
Specific target organ toxicity - single exposure GHS chapter 3.8 Category 3 H335 GHS07

α,α-dichlorotoluene hazard statements (H-codes)

Hazard statements assigned to α,α-dichlorotoluene
CodeHazard statement
H351 Suspected of causing cancer <state route of exposure if it is conclusively proven that no other routes of exposure cause the hazard>.
H331 Toxic if inhaled.
H302 Harmful if swallowed.
H335 May cause respiratory irritation.
H315 Causes skin irritation.
H318 Causes serious eye damage.

Safety Data Sheet

Getting an SDS for α,α-dichlorotoluene

A Safety Data Sheet is written for a product, not for a substance: the supplier of the grade you actually buy issues it, so two suppliers of α,α-dichlorotoluene issue two different sheets. That is why there is no single authoritative SDS for a substance to download — what there is, is the job of collecting the sheets for the products you hold and keeping them current as suppliers revise them.

07 · Health hazards

α,α-dichlorotoluene health hazards and exposure limits

α,α-dichlorotoluene hazard summary

A severe skin, eye, and respiratory tract irritant; [ICSC] Strong lachrymator; [HSDB] An irritant; Harmful if swallowed; Toxic by inhalation; May cause serious eye damage; Causes general anesthesia in animal experiments; [MSDSonline]

Source: Haz-Map, Information on Hazardous Chemicals and Occupational Diseases

α,α-dichlorotoluene carcinogenicity classification

Evaluation: There is limited evidence in humans for the carcinogenicity of alpha-chlorinated toluenes and benzoyl chloride. ... There is limited evidence in experimental animals for the carcinogenicity of benzal chloride. ... Overall evaluation: Combined exposures to alpha-chlorinated toluenes and benzoyl chloride are probably carcinogenic to humans (Group 2A). /alpha-Chlorinated toluenes & benzoyl chloride/

Source: Hazardous Substances Data Bank (HSDB)

An IARC group and a CLP classification answer different questions. IARC judges whether the evidence for cancer in humans is strong enough; CLP Annex VI is the legally binding EU classification. A substance can carry one and not the other.

10 · Handling and storage

α,α-dichlorotoluene storage and handling

α,α-dichlorotoluene safe storage

Separated from food and feedstuffs. See Chemical Dangers. Ventilation along the floor.

Source: ILO-WHO International Chemical Safety Cards (ICSCs)

α,α-dichlorotoluene incompatible materials

... REACTS WITH WATER TO RELEASE HYDROCHLORIC ACID.

Source: Hazardous Substances Data Bank (HSDB)

α,α-dichlorotoluene reactivity

BENZYLIDENE CHLORIDE is incompatible with strong oxidizers and strong bases. It readily hydrolyzes under acid or alkaline conditions. It reacts with metals (except nickel and lead). (NTP, 1992).

Source: CAMEO Chemicals

11 · Transport

α,α-dichlorotoluene UN number and transport classification

Transport classification is a separate system from the GHS classification above. It decides how a package is marked and how a load may be carried; it does not follow from the workplace label, and the workplace label does not follow from it. The entries below are linked by CAS number, never by name.

α,α-dichlorotoluene under UN 1886 — shipping name, class and packing group

Europe · ADR 2025, Table A

Proper shipping name (3.1.2) Class Classification code PG Labels (column 5)
BENZYLIDENE CHLORIDE 6.1 T1 II
  • ADR label model 6.1 — Toxic substance
6.1

Source: ADR 2025, Table A of Chapter 3.2 · ECE/TRANS/352 Vol. I (UNECE). Class 6.1 is “Toxic substances” (ADR 2.1.1.1).

Proper shipping name (column 2) Class or division PG Labels (column 6)
Benzylidene chloride 6.1 II
  • US DOT POISON label (§172.430)
6.1

Source: 49 CFR 172.101 Hazardous Materials Table · eCFR, revision 2026-08-03. Class 6.1 is “Poisonous materials” (49 CFR 173.2).

12 · Questions

α,α-dichlorotoluene — frequently asked questions

What is the CAS number of α,α-dichlorotoluene?

The CAS number of α,α-dichlorotoluene is 98-87-3. Its EC number is 202-709-2.

What is the chemical formula of α,α-dichlorotoluene?

The molecular formula of α,α-dichlorotoluene is C7H6Cl2 and its molecular weight is 161.03 g/mol.

What does a α,α-dichlorotoluene label have to show?

Under CLP Annex VI the label for α,α-dichlorotoluene carries the pictograms Skull and crossbones, Health hazard and Corrosion and the signal word is Danger.

Is α,α-dichlorotoluene flammable?

CLP Annex VI assigns α,α-dichlorotoluene no flammability hazard class. That is not a statement that it cannot burn: the harmonised list only records the hazards that were assessed for it. The flash point reported for it is 92.22 °C (198 °F) (CAMEO).

Is α,α-dichlorotoluene a carcinogen?

CLP Annex VI assigns α,α-dichlorotoluene H351 — suspected of causing cancer. That is category 2: the evidence points that way but is not conclusive.

What is the boiling point of α,α-dichlorotoluene?

The boiling point reported for α,α-dichlorotoluene is 205 °C (401 °F) (HSDB).

What is the melting point of α,α-dichlorotoluene?

The melting point reported for α,α-dichlorotoluene is -16.4 °C (2.5 °F) (HSDB).
